Lavender Lemonade Popsicles

Refreshing Lavender Lemonade Popsicles for a Sweet Summer Treat

Refreshing Lavender Lemonade Popsicles are a delightful summer treat that combines floral lavender and zesty lemon flavors.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Resting Time 2 hours
Total Time 5 hours
Servings: 6 popsicles
Course: Desserts
Calories: 80

Ingredients
  

For the Popsicles
  • 4 cups Water Filtered water for enhanced flavor.
  • 1/4 cup Culinary Lavender Use culinary-grade for safety.
  • 1/3 cup Sugar Can substitute with honey or agave.
  • 2 large Lemons Freshly squeezed for maximum brightness.

Equipment

  • Small Saucepan
  • Fine mesh sieve
  • popsicle molds
  • manual juicer

Method
 

Directions
  1. In a small saucepan, bring 4 cups of filtered water to a boil over medium heat.
  2. Remove the saucepan from heat and add 1/4 cup of culinary lavender, letting it steep for 10 minutes.
  3. Juice 2 large lemons until you have a bright and tangy lemon juice.
  4. In a mixing bowl, combine the strained lavender water, freshly squeezed lemon juice, and 1/3 cup of sugar.
  5. Carefully pour the mixture into popsicle molds, leaving a small gap at the top.
  6. Let the filled molds sit at room temperature for about 2-3 hours, then freeze for at least 4 hours.
  7. To release popsicles, dip the molds in warm water for about 10 seconds.

Notes

For best results, strain lavender after 10 minutes to avoid bitterness. Store popsicles in a sealed bag for up to 2 months.
